Re: Why Does my Car Look like this ingame???

Post by Oleg »

wrong shaders or wrong textures. possibly using textures with alpha when textures without alpha needed. misplaced parts are mostly caused by incorrect hierarchy (or a case when model_hi.yft and model.yft have different hierarchy : both files have to be exported out of the same scene).

Re: Why Does my Car Look like this ingame???

Post by Oleg »

for me it looks like you can merge all (most of) parts inside extra_b using Modify\Attach. Separation to parts is needed when they behave differently in game (e.g. animated by some scripts as separate parts). making a lot of parts during modelling is Ok too (e.g. creating a "cup holder", "cup", "plastic_clip" etc.), but these are not needed when you export your model into the game.
